Handover note — Crumbwheel order cutoffs.

Welcome aboard. The bakery cutoff rule in Crumbwheel closes same-day orders at 14:00 local to each storefront, not UTC — this has bitten us twice. Holiday overrides live in the calendar service and take precedence silently, so always check there first when a cutoff looks wrong. To unlock the calendar service's admin console after a restart, enter the recovery passphrase below.

vault phrase of bagap-bahaf = silion-pelox-sorox-casdor-quenwyn-fraax-eliox-praael-kelion-quenvan-kasox-rusael-norius-belvan

## TumbleKey Environments

TumbleKey handles the locker-access flow for the Spindlewick laundry rooms. We run three environments: dev (fake lockers, instant unlocks), staging (real locker hardware in the test closet), and prod. Staging is the one to demo at the sync — it behaves like prod but resets codes nightly. Prod changes need a release ticket. Staging currently runs with the following configuration.

service settings:
[briius]
port = 3000
region = outer-1
host = briius.zarqeldyn.internal
team = wenael
timeout_ms = 2000
retries = 5

// Notes for the weekly eng sync re: Gallerywhisper, our museum audio-guide app.
// This constant sets the prefetch radius for exhibit audio clips. At the
// Hollen Pavilion pilot we learned visitors walk faster than our original
// estimate, so clips were buffering mid-stride. Bumping this to three rooms
// ahead fixed it, at a modest bandwidth cost. Don't lower it without testing
// on the slow gallery wifi first — seriously, it's painful. The trace token
// from the pilot build that validated this number is appended just below.

trace token, kahap-bagaf: htk4_8458

Subject: Partner SFTP drop — new owner

Hi,

As you review the pending changes to the Harborline ingest scripts, note that ownership of the partner SFTP drop is changing at the end of the month. This includes key rotation, the nightly pull job, and the quarantine folder for malformed files. Review comments on the retry logic should still go through the normal PR flow, but questions about drop-folder conventions or partner onboarding now go to the new owner. The incoming owner is listed below.

signatory, tagaf-bahaf: Praael Fenmir Rusok